#399D4F Color
#399D4F is rgb(57, 157, 79) in RGB, hsl(133, 47%, 42%) in HSL, and about cmyk(64%, 0%, 50%, 38%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Spanish Green (#009150),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.95.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#399D4F Channel Values
How #399D4F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 57 · G 157 · B 79 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 133° · S 47% · L 42%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 133° · S 64% · V 62%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 64% · M 0% · Y 50% · K 38%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.44:1 vs white · 6.11: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#399D4F background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#399D4F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#399D4F?
#399D4F is a mid-tone green — rgb(57, 157, 79) in RGB and hsl(133, 47%, 42%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Spanish Green (#009150),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.95.
What is the RGB value of #399D4F?
#399D4F is rgb(57, 157, 79) — red 57, green 157, and blue 79 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#399D4F?
#399D4F converts to approximately cmyk(64%, 0%, 50%, 38%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#399D4F be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#399D4F scores 3.44:1 against white and 6.11: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#399D4F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#399D4F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umseagreen (#3CB371) at a CIE76 distance of 11.35, which is visibly different.
